LED activation and deactivation timings.
1) RAM test
RAM write/read test is conducted.
The
contents
of the
RAM
are
destroyed.
The
option
RAM will not be tested.
2) Display test
The display controller
is tested first. Then the display
contents,
1 thru
7 discussed in the machine based test,
are displayed repeatedly.
3) Printer test
The printer controller is tested first. Then, the printout
contents,
1 thru
7 discussed in the machine based test,
are displayed repeatedly. (Europe font is not printed.)
4) Key test
The key controller is tested first. Then, when any key is
depressed, the LED blinks off/on.
